The conference "Orality
and New Dimensions of Orality. Intersections in
theories and materials in African studies" will be
held at the University of Leiden on 26 - 27 November
2004.
Keynote speaker: Professor Karin Barber (University of Birmingham)
Orality is an essential means for mental and emotive
exchange as well as for artistic expression. However,
oral communication in African languages has taken on
new dimensions given by the increasing presence of
literacy and technical media. Therefore, in this
conference we intend to address the actual forms that
African Orality takes in present contexts of
communication and literary creation marked by the
diffusion of print, radio, television and more recently
the Internet. We ask attention for oral communication
in rural, urban and new international spaces (created
by electronic media) as well as for interactions
between languages and styles.
